Africa 10XG Foundation partners with Mountain of Fire and Miracles Ministries (MFM) to equip children and teenagers with ethical leadership, health literacy, and resilience.


Across Africa, the Church is at the heart of many communities, with worship at its centre. It is where faith is celebrated, generations come together, relationships are built, and young people gain a sense of identity and belonging. Here, values are nurtured, and responsibility towards others is encouraged. 


For Africa 10XG Foundation, this makes the Church a crucial partner in preparing Africa's next generation of ethical leaders.


On 13 September 2026, Africa 10XG Foundation will partner with Mountain of Fire and Miracles Ministries (MFM) in Nigeria's Afolabi community to deliver Roots to Resilience: Ethical Leadership and Health Literacy for Rural Children and Teens.

The programme will bring together children and teenagers aged 7–18 for age-appropriate learning focused on ethical leadership, health literacy, resilience, mentorship, and responsible participation in their communities.

The Church as a partner in raising the next generation


Across sub-Saharan Africa, millions of children and teenagers are growing up with significant gaps in the support and opportunities available to them. One in five children of primary-school age is out of school, and only two in three complete primary school by age 15. The region also has the highest adolescent birth rate in the world.


Yet school and health are only part of the picture. Young people are making decisions about friendships, identity, health, education, and their futures while facing influences that extend far beyond their immediate communities and countries.

They need knowledge, but they also need values, trusted guidance, and people willing to walk alongside them.


Churches are uniquely placed to contribute to this journey.


Their presence within communities enables consistent engagement with children, teenagers, and families. Alongside spiritual development, they can reinforce values such as honesty, compassion, accountability, service, and respect, while providing positive role models and space for important conversations.


Through this partnership, Mountain of Fire and Miracles Ministries (MFM) brings community reach, while Africa 10XG provides structured learning in ethical leadership, youth development, and practical life skills.


Together, they aim to equip young people with the character, knowledge, and confidence to make choices that strengthen their lives and communities.


From ethical leadership to everyday choices


Ethical leadership can sometimes sound like a subject reserved for governments, boardrooms or people in senior positions.


We believe it begins much earlier.


For a child or teenager, leadership may mean choosing honesty when dishonesty appears easier, resisting harmful peer pressure, treating another person with respect, accepting responsibility for a mistake, or having the courage to make a healthier choice.


These everyday decisions help shape character.

The ethical leadership component of Roots to Resilience will explore values, honesty, accountability, empathy, respect, service, corruption and its effects, responsible decision-making and community-minded leadership.


Alongside this, age-appropriate health literacy sessions will help young people better understand hygiene, prevention, self-care, substance misuse prevention, reproductive health awareness, disease prevention, credible sources of information and when and where to seek help.


Children under nine will participate in a separate age-appropriate section, ensuring that learning remains relevant and accessible across age groups.


Resilient communities are strengthened when young people have the values to make responsible decisions and the knowledge to make informed ones.

Learning that continues beyond the room


Roots to Resilience has been designed as a participatory experience rather than a one-way presentation.


Young people will be encouraged to ask questions, reflect on values, learn alongside their peers and engage with mentors. Pre- and post-session assessments and participant feedback will help Africa 10XG understand what has changed as a result of the intervention and where future programmes can be strengthened.


Importantly, the learning is intended to travel.


Teenage participants will be encouraged to share key lessons with two peers following the programme, extending the reach of the intervention beyond those physically present on the day.

The intended outcomes include stronger ethical decision-making, improved health knowledge, greater resilience against harmful behaviours and peer pressure, increased confidence and communication, and a stronger sense of responsibility towards the wider community.
